Abstract

Elderly primary health care in urban health care centers is influenced by many factors. The quality primary health care in urban health care centers is of great importance and complexity and pan dimensionality of the care in these centers requires multiple interpretations that necessitate exploring and describing the perspectives of whom involved in care giving to understand the factors affecting the quality of care. This study was carried out with the aim of exploring and describing the factors involved in quality elderly primary health care in urban health care centers of Isfahan, Iran. Qualitative research was conducted using unstructured interviews, focus group discussion and participant observations. Data revealed that structural factors including micro or inter organizational conditions and macro or ultra organizational conditions have influenced the quality of elderly primary health care. Micro conditions refer to the conditions relating to health care system and included five categories of problems and conditions related to health care planning, human resource related issues, fundamental problems in the health care system, factors related to possibilities and facilities and factors related to access to health care. Macro conditions included social problems and issues, economical problems and issues and cultural problems and issues. Interaction between micro and macro conditions resulted in indifference to health care of health care providers and elderly clients and poor quality of care. Findings were suggestive of correcting and modifying the micro and macro conditions and comprehensive ecological approach in promoting elderly primary health care. © Medwell Journals, 2009.
